Courtney Act says it was ‘poetic’ her skirt fell off in front of Anne Widdecombe

Courtney Act thought it was "poetic" when her skirt fell off in front of Anne Widdecombe.
The 36-year-old drag star has recalled the moment she entered the ‘Celebrity Big Brother’ house and her skirt was completely ripped off, saying it was somehow appropriate that the incident happened in front of the former politician.
Courtney – who has previously accused Anne of "bigotry" – told BuzzFeed: "I was otherwise distracted because my skirt had fallen off and I was trying to compose myself.
"It was kind of all puffed and rushy and then I was telling them, ‘Oh my god, my skirt had just fallen off.’
"And they were like ,’Oh I’m sure that nobody noticed, it’s fine,’ and I was like ‘No no no, my skirt had literally [Courtney imitates her skirt coming off].’
"And it fell off again in front of Ann Widdecombe, which is sort of poetic I think."
Courtney also went on to explain how she was "taken aback" on her first day on the reality TV show ‘Ru Paul’s Drag Race’.
She said: "I think the thing that you are really taken by is that you realise it is actually a set.
"I genuinely had always thought, this sounds dumb, I always thought that ‘RuPaul’s Drag Race’ was shot in the basement of RuPaul’s house.
"I always pictured him up upstairs in his sunken living room and he’s like, ‘Alright, time to go down and see the girls,’ and he trapes down the steps into the basement (a well-lit basement, but a basement nonetheless).
"And then I was like, ‘Wait a minute, these aren’t real bricks! These are just photographs of bricks printed on to fabric It’s all an illusion!’"
